‘Poland has transformed into an immigration state’ – Polish government moves to shorten approval time for foreign workers as over 500,000 migrants apply for residency

Poland has long been one of the most homogenous European nations, featuring a nation that identifies as between 95 and 97 percent ethnically Polish. However, the groundwork is being laid for more and more transformative immigration, including with a new proposal that could rapidly boost the number of residency permits approved.
